I just took apart a 244 for a rebuild. The boot looked black, but when I cut it off I realized it was just black from age/use, and it was originally green!

I checked a page of sellers from google, they only have the same blue boot. Does anyone know if the green one is still available?

Back in the day I helped put many of those together (thousands), and I really liked the tool. Didn't like that air diffuser on the exhaust though. The only green boot I can remember being offical wasn't made for the 244, but the IR 199 (if I got the model right- very limited production).

IR_GUY: Thanks for reading this. Protoco never got back to me, so I ordered a boot and rebuild kit from toolfetch.com. When it came, I was surprised to find a red boot (which I later saw in that link you just posted). All internet stores have the blue pic, but it looks like IR only makes red. I prefer red over blue anyway (although green might have been best).
